What is Xmplify?

Xmplify is a macOS application specifically designed for 64-bit systems, aimed at delivering a thorough XML editing experience. It significantly enhances user interaction by offering smart editing tools and real-time suggestions tailored to the XML content in use. An outline view is included, which visually displays the structure of the document and updates in real-time as modifications occur. For documents that incorporate a DTD or XML Schema, Xmplify automatically conducts content validation and provides auto-completion options that align with the document's definitions, along with pertinent documentation for each suggestion. In instances where a DTD or Schema is absent, Xmplify can independently derive one, ensuring precise auto-completion capabilities. Beyond these features, the application facilitates quick navigation to element definitions, supports XSL transformations via both built-in and external processors, and provides live web previews for (X)HTML documents. Additionally, it boasts powerful search functions that utilize XPath and regular expressions, making it an essential tool for both developers and writers engaged with XML, ultimately streamlining the editing process and enhancing productivity.

What is XMLBlueprint?

XMLBlueprint is an intelligent XML editor designed for Windows that offers support for DTD, Relax NG, and Schematron, in addition to XSLT versions 1.0 through 3.0 and XPath versions 1.0, 2.0, and 3.1. This software stands out as an ideal solution for managing XML tasks efficiently, thanks to its comprehensive features combined with a reasonable pricing structure. Moreover, XMLBlueprint enables users to validate and modify substantial XML documents, with the capability to handle files as large as 1 gigabyte seamlessly. Its user-friendly interface further enhances the editing experience, making it suitable for both beginners and experienced developers alike.

What is EditRocket?

EditRocket serves as a comprehensive text and source code editor that operates seamlessly across macOS, Windows, and Linux, featuring an array of XML editing tools designed to enhance user productivity and ease of use. One of its standout features is the XML Validator, which enables users to check the syntax of XML files and, with the "check schema" option enabled, validate these files against established schemas. Additionally, the XML Tag Navigator analyzes the document's content and presents XML tags in a format that users can click on, allowing for swift navigation to specific tag locations within the text. The XML Sidekick offers tabs dedicated to coding inserts, utilities, and the XML Tag Navigator, making it easy to quickly insert XML elements via buttons or customizable keyboard shortcuts. Another useful feature is the XML Tag Completion, which automatically generates closing tags following an opening tag with a user-configurable delay for the completion process. Beyond its XML functionalities, EditRocket also supports syntax highlighting for over 20 programming languages and includes a variety of helpful coding sidekicks and tools for code development, establishing it as a versatile option for developers. Consequently, EditRocket not only simplifies the coding process but also enhances the overall efficiency of users who engage with different programming languages and XML files. Its robust capabilities make EditRocket an exceptional choice for anyone aiming to optimize their coding experience.
